WebMar 11, 2024 · Form 1116. Claiming the foreign tax credit is as simple as putting a number on your tax return when you paid only a small amount of foreign taxes. The IRS sets that threshold at $300 for single filers and $600 for married filing jointly. When you paid more than $300/$600 in foreign taxes, the IRS doesn’t give the credit as easily.
